How To Troubleshoot

  1. Bring in the car

    Next

  2. Interview and phenomenon check
    1. Perform the interview and phenomenon check (Refer to CHECK LIST FOR INTERVIEW  )

      Next

  3. Basic inspection
    1. Inspect the battery voltage.

      Voltage: 11 to 14 V

    2. According to the parts arrangement drawing and/or circuit figure, check the blown fuse, broken wire harness, short circuit, and/or improper connection that can be inspected visually.
      NOTE: If battery voltage is 11 V or less, recharge or replace the battery before starting the diagnostic program.

      Next

  4. Communication function inspection of large-scale multiplex communication system for vehicle body [LIN]
    1. Inspect communication function of large-scale multiplex communication system for vehicle body [LIN] using SSM3, and make sure that there is no fault in the communication system. (Refer to CHECKING/CLEARING DIAGNOSTIC CODES )
      NOTE: For output diagnostic code, see the LIST OF DIAGNOSTIC CODES 
      RESULT

      Result Go to
      Communication function of large-scale multiplex communication system for vehicle body [LIN] is normal.
      [No diagnostic code output (LIN communication fault, ECM communication fault/communication breakdown)]
      A
      Communication function of large-scale multiplex communication system for vehicle body [LIN] has fault.
      [Diagnostic code output (LIN communication fault, ECM communication fault/communication breakdown) exist]
      B

      B: Go to "Large-scale multiplex communication system for vehicle body [LIN]" (Refer to LIST OF DIAGNOSTIC CODES )

      A: Go to Next Step

  5. DTC check
    1. Using SSM3, check that there is no DTC displayed. (Refer to CHECKING/CLEARING DIAGNOSTIC CODES  )
      NOTE: For output diagnostic code, see the LIST OF DIAGNOSTIC CODES , .
      RESULT

      Result Go to
      No DTC output A
      DTC output B2311 and B2314. B
      DTC output B2312 and B2315. C
      DTC output B2313 and B2316. D

      B: Go to the troubleshooting flowchart for DTC B2311 and B2314 (Refer to DTC B2311 DRIVER'S SEAT PULSE FAILURE ABNORMAL DETECTION; DTC B2314 PASSENGER'S SEAT PULSE FAILURE ABNORMAL DETECTION  ).

      C: Go to the troubleshooting flowchart for DTC B2312 and B2315 (Refer to DTC B2312 DRIVER'S SEAT SW ON STUCK; DTC B2315 PASSENGER'S SEAT SW ON STUCK  ).

      D: Go to the troubleshooting flowchart for DTC B2313 and B2316 (Refer to DTC B2313 DRIVER'S SEAT GLASS POSITION, WINDOW SLIDE CHARACTERISTIC DATA NOT RECORDED STATUS DETECTION; DTC B2316 PASSENGER'S SEAT GLASS POSITION, WINDOW SLIDE CHARACTERISTIC DATA NOT RECORDED STATUS DETECTION  ).

      A: Go to Next Step

  6. Symptom table
    1. Check the symptom table. (Refer to SYMPTOM TABLE  )
      RESULT

      Result Go to
      Not applicable to the symptom table. A
      Applicable to the symptom table. B

      B: Go to Step  8

      A: Go to Next Step

  7. Perform troubleshooting based on the malfunction symptom with the following methods.
    1. Function check (refer to FUNCTION INSPECTION  )
    2. Display of current data/system operation check mode (Refer to DISPLAY OF CURRENT DATA/SYSTEM OPERATION CHECK MODE  ).
    3. ECM terminal matrix (Refer to ECM TERMINAL ARRANGEMENT  )
    4. Unit inspection

      Next

  8. Adjustment, repair, or replacement
    RESULT

    Result Go to
    Replacement or removal/installation work is done for door window regulator and power window regulator motor assembly for each seat. A
    No replacement or removal/installation work is not done for door window regulator and power window regulator motor assembly for each seat. B

    B: Go to Step  10

    A: Go to Next Step

  9. Power window regulator motor initialization (pulse sensor initialization)
    1. Perform the glass position reset on the worked area. (Refer to FUNCTION INSPECTION  )
      NOTE: If the initialization is not performed, AUTO operation, auto-reverse function, and after-key-OFF operation function does not work.

      Next

  10. Confirmation test

    Next: Complete
